Rearrange these words into a well-known phrase or saying. on 07:44 - May 9 with 1981 views | Guthrum | That does make sense if we were entering the post domestic infection phase of the disease (i.e. after it's been virtually eradicated within the UK). In that situation, most new cases are people entering the country, rather than catching it when already here. We're not anywhere close to that yet. So I think it's more jumping the gun than shutting the stable door. |  |

Agreed. The government is incompetent and ought to have been quarantining new arrivals, especially from Italy, Spain and China, months ago but since they didn't do that there's been relatively little point in quarantine since community transmission became rife. Quarantine will be useful once we've got the numbers significantly down as you say, it'll stop us importing new infections at a point where there are few infections happening domestically. |  |
